Java開發(fā)平臺(tái)IntelliJ IDEA教程:Play 2.x入門
IntelliJ IDEA是Java語言開發(fā)的集成環(huán)境,IntelliJ在業(yè)界被公認(rèn)為優(yōu)秀的Java開發(fā)工具之一,尤其在智能代碼助手、代碼自動(dòng)提示、重構(gòu)、J2EE支持、Ant、JUnit、CVS整合、代碼審查、 創(chuàng)新的GUI設(shè)計(jì)等方面的功能可以說是超常的。
IntelliJ IDEA現(xiàn)已更新至2019.2版本,新版本改進(jìn)了java13預(yù)覽等20余項(xiàng)功能,提高了開發(fā)效率,趕快下載體驗(yàn)吧~(點(diǎn)擊查看更新詳情)
Play 2.x入門
僅Ultimate Edition 支持此功能。
在開始生成Play項(xiàng)目之前,請確保已在IntelliJ IDEA中下載并啟用了Scala插件 。
IntelliJ IDEA支持Play版本2.4和更高版本。
讓我們看一下以下在IntelliJ IDEA中生成Play 2項(xiàng)目的常見方案:
如果您已經(jīng)有一個(gè)Play 2項(xiàng)目,則可以將其導(dǎo)入或從版本控制中簽出。在這種情況下,您可以按照常規(guī)過程導(dǎo)入 或克隆項(xiàng)目。
如果您不熟悉Play 2框架,并且想學(xué)習(xí)如何使用它,請通過IntelliJ IDEA創(chuàng)建一個(gè)Play項(xiàng)目,該項(xiàng)目將生成一個(gè)可執(zhí)行應(yīng)用程序。
如果要查看可以生成哪種類型的Play 2項(xiàng)目,請使用 Lightbend Project Starter 并使用提供的模板之一創(chuàng)建項(xiàng)目。
如果要手動(dòng)添加對Play 2框架的支持,請創(chuàng)建一個(gè)sbt項(xiàng)目。
創(chuàng)建一個(gè)新的Play 2項(xiàng)目
1、打開“ 新建項(xiàng)目”向?qū)?。從右?cè)的選項(xiàng)中,選擇“ Play2.x”。
2、按照向?qū)е薪ㄗh的步驟操作,然后單擊“ 完成”。
IntelliJ IDEA生成具有適當(dāng)結(jié)構(gòu),依賴項(xiàng)和可執(zhí)行應(yīng)用程序的Play 2項(xiàng)目。
創(chuàng)建具有Lightbend項(xiàng)目起動(dòng)器Play 2模板
1、打開一個(gè)新的項(xiàng)目向?qū)?,然后從右?cè)的選項(xiàng)中選擇Lightbend Project Starter。
2、在向?qū)У南乱豁撋?,選擇要用于項(xiàng)目的模板。例如,選擇 Play Scala Seed模板,該模板將創(chuàng)建一個(gè)可執(zhí)行的Play模板項(xiàng)目以開發(fā)您的Play應(yīng)用程序。
點(diǎn)擊完成。
使用Play 2框架創(chuàng)建sbt項(xiàng)目
1、創(chuàng)建一個(gè)sbt項(xiàng)目。
按照向?qū)е薪ㄗh的步驟操作,然后單擊“ 完成”。
IntelliJ IDEA創(chuàng)建一個(gè)sbt項(xiàng)目。
2、在編輯器中打開build.sbt文件,并將Play添加為項(xiàng)目依賴項(xiàng)。
3、在“ 項(xiàng)目工具”窗口中的項(xiàng)目源根目錄中,選擇“ 新建” |“新建”。文件創(chuàng)建plugins.sbt文件。
4、在編輯器中打開plugins.sbt文件,然后添加Play 2插件。
IntelliJ IDEA下載適當(dāng)?shù)囊蕾図?xiàng)并將其添加到sbt項(xiàng)目工具窗口中的“ 依賴關(guān)系”節(jié)點(diǎn)。
請注意,不會(huì)生成Play 2框架項(xiàng)目結(jié)構(gòu),您需要手動(dòng)添加所有內(nèi)容。檢查Play 2項(xiàng)目結(jié)構(gòu)。
此時(shí),您可以開始創(chuàng)建Play 2模板,因?yàn)橐坏┨砑恿藢lay 2框架的支持,IntelliJ IDEA就會(huì)支持它們,并進(jìn)一步開發(fā)您的項(xiàng)目。您可以在Play 2文件中使用代碼完成,導(dǎo)航和動(dòng)態(tài)代碼分析功能。IntelliJ IDEA還支持用于路由文件和代碼檢查的代碼幫助。
運(yùn)行和調(diào)試Play 2應(yīng)用程序
如果要運(yùn)行該應(yīng)用程序:1、在項(xiàng)目工具窗口中,右鍵單擊該應(yīng)用程序。
2、在上下文菜單中,選擇“運(yùn)行Play 2 App”。
如果需要訪問“ 運(yùn)行/調(diào)試配置”對話框:1、在主菜單上,選擇運(yùn)行|。編輯配置。
2、單擊,然后選擇Play 2 App創(chuàng)建新配置。
3、指定運(yùn)行/調(diào)試配置設(shè)置。默認(rèn)設(shè)置足以運(yùn)行和調(diào)試。
4、在主工具欄上,單擊圖標(biāo)以運(yùn)行或調(diào)試應(yīng)用程序。
您可以在默認(rèn)瀏覽器http:// localhost:9000中檢查應(yīng)用程序的輸出。如果要停止服務(wù)器會(huì)話,請按 Alt+D (Cmd+P對于macOS)。
您可以使用Play 2設(shè)置來配置編譯器選項(xiàng)并配置路由文件的格式。您還可以查看和編輯默認(rèn)模板導(dǎo)入的列表。
1、按Ctrl+Alt+S然后從左側(cè)的選項(xiàng)中選擇 Languages Frameworks |。播放2。
2、根據(jù)您要配置的設(shè)置,在Play2設(shè)置頁面上,選擇適當(dāng)?shù)倪x項(xiàng)卡并調(diào)整設(shè)置。使用其他選項(xiàng)卡來檢查和編輯刷新項(xiàng)目時(shí)從描述符中檢索到的模板導(dǎo)入的列表。
要手動(dòng)添加模板,刪除或編輯現(xiàn)有模板,請選擇“ 手動(dòng)選擇模板導(dǎo)入”選項(xiàng),以使“ 導(dǎo)入”部分處于活動(dòng)狀態(tài),并相應(yīng)地調(diào)整導(dǎo)入列表。
=====================================================
IntelliJ IDEA示例/使用教程/視頻資源合集,請點(diǎn)擊此處查看
想要了解或購買IntelliJ IDEA正版授權(quán)的朋友,歡迎咨詢慧都官方客服
關(guān)注下方微信公眾號,及時(shí)獲取產(chǎn)品最新消息和最新資訊